White Mountain, AK Analemma
Due to Earth's tilted axis and slightly elliptical orbit, the Sun is never seen in the same position at noon in White Mountain. Throughout the year, it slowly traces this figure-eight:
Move along the curve to read the Sun's altitude and azimuth for any day of the year in White Mountain.
Over the year, the 12:00 Sun ranges from 0.8° below the horizon (around Dec 24) to 44.7° above it (around Jun 18) in White Mountain. The smaller loop sits at the top, the signature of a Northern Hemisphere analemma. For about 33 days around midwinter the whole figure sinks below the horizon — the Sun does not rise at noon at all. Notice the whole figure leans east of the meridian: over White Mountain the Sun reaches its highest point between 13:37 and 14:07 depending on the time of year, but never at 12:00.

Why does the figure look wider here than in the sky view above?
Both draw the same data, but with different conventions. The sky view uses the same scale on both axes, so it shows the analemma with its true proportions, as a camera would capture it: about 47° tall and only a few degrees wide. This chart, like most technical analemma diagrams, stretches each axis independently to fill the plot, expanding the narrow azimuth range several times so its day-to-day variation can actually be read. Also, azimuth is not sky distance: near the zenith, one degree of azimuth spans much less than one degree across the sky, which further widens the figure in this representation.
